Week Plan

Week Topic Preparation Methods
1 Relations of Organic agriculture and Plant Protection General introduction, lecture notes and general topics, General introduction, lecture notes and mentioning of general topics, notification of lesson week
2 PomeFruit Diseases (Apple, Pear, Quince)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
3 StoneFruit Diseases (Cherry, Sour Cherry, Apricot, Plum)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
4 StoneFruit Diseases (Peach, Nectarine)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
5 Hard Shell Fruit Diseases (Walnuts, Almonds, Hazelnuts, Chestnuts, Pistachios)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
6 Citrus di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
7 Grape Di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of Exam
8 Midterm exam Midterm Exam order, next week notice of lesson
9 Tomato, Pepper and Eggplant Di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
10 Winter Vegetable Di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
11 Cucurbit Di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
12 Greenhouse Disease Associations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
13 Potatoe Di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
14 Cereal di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of lesson
15 Berries Fruit Diseases Previous week's repetition, next week notice of Final
